10-bit current-output DAC with 110 ns settling
The AD5451YUJZ-REEL7 is a 10-bit multiplying DAC with a current-unbuffered R-2R output stage, settling to within ±0.5 LSB in 110 ns — fast enough for waveform reconstruction in the low-MHz range or for closed-loop setpoint updates in a servo loop. The R-2R ladder architecture means the output current scales linearly with the external reference voltage, making it a true multiplying DAC — the reference can be an AC signal, not just a DC rail.
Single-supply mixed-signal integration
The SPI/DSP-compatible serial interface uses a standard 3-wire protocol (SCLK, SDIN, SYNC) that ties directly to most MCU SPI peripherals or a DSP synchronous serial port. No differential output — the single-ended current output (IOUT) is typically fed into an external op-amp I-V converter; the feedback resistor is on-chip to match the R-2R temperature coefficient.
TSOT-23-8 package and temperature range
Housed in a thin SOT-23-8 (TSOT-23-8) package, the AD5451YUJZ-REEL7 occupies about 9 mm² of board area — fits into space-constrained portable or industrial modules.
